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59556296 2326404127 688
269 15972
269 15972
50 968022629 2850 0858067735
All about undefined
Interested in learning more?
269 15972
50 968022629 2850 0858067735
See more
83643383109 76469 136
4440088797 03765483 1365689649
See more
3462 456153404
489 185 9852080206 34 38
See more